Pytorch之可視化


先解決下keras可視化安裝graphviz的問題:

注意安裝順序:

sudo pip3 install graphviz  # python包

sudo apt-get install graphviz   # 軟件本身

sudo pip3 install pydot

sudo pip3 install pydot-ng  # 版本兼容需要,可選

 

1.  使用pytorchviz進行pytorch執行過程的可視化

sudo pip3 install git   # 安裝git
sudo  pip3 install git+https://github.com/szagoruyko/pytorchviz   # github上的包

demo:

model = nn.Sequential()
model.add_module('W0', nn.Linear(8, 16))
model.add_module('tanh', nn.Tanh())
model.add_module('W1', nn.Linear(16, 1))

x = Variable(torch.randn(1,8))
y = model(x)

make_dot(y.mean(), params=dict(model.named_parameters()))

 

詳見: https://github.com/szagoruyko/pytorchviz


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M